An Individualized Education Program (IEP) is a special education high school diploma typically awarded to individuals receiving special education services. Requirements for these types of diplomas are unique to each student's needs/abilities and may not provide access to the general education curriculum.
While an IEP 'diploma' is recognition of an individual student's achievement of his or her educational goals based on the appropriate level of the learning standards as specified in the student's current IEP, it is not a standards-based diploma and not recognized in this State as equivalent to a regular high school

The Alternate Diploma is a diploma that is allowable under the Every Student Succeeds Act (ESSAY) issued in accordance with USE Board Rule R277-705-5 for a student who is determined through the IEP process to be a student. The Alternate Diploma is not based solely on meeting a student's IEP goals.
A high school diploma signifies that a student has met all the requirements for graduation. A certificate of completion signifies that a student has completed high school but did not meet some requirements for graduation.
Certificates consist of courses that help you develop career competency in a single subject. A diploma is similar to certification but is usually more in depth. Many schools offer diploma programs in nursing, for instance, which is generally a two-year program of course work and on the job training.
